Workplane Intersection

Estimated reading: 3 minutes 3 views

In this Task 

The Workplane will be moved to another position on the model. The intersecting plane of the model and the Workplane will be displayed.

The Sphere will be sliced by the Workplane. The sliced lower portion will be used to modify the upper portion of the sphere.

 Workplane Intersection

Ribbon : Workspace | Workplanes | WorkPlane | Show 3D Intersections
Palette : 3D Model | Workplane | Workplane Intersection
This Workplane feature shows, by means of a red dashed outline, the plane where the solid object intersects with the Workplane.This Workplane feature is only displayed when Show/Hide Workplane is activated.

Place the Workplane on the top face of the revolved object, shown below, using the Workplane by Facet tool.

To display where the Workplane intersects with the solid, the Show/Hide Workplane Intersection tool is used.

Select Show/Hide Workplane Intersection from the Workplane menu then turn the view to Front and place the Workplane in the approximate position to that shown below using the Workplane Origin tool. 

The intersection of the Workplane and the solid should be displayed, similar to the illustration, below, when rendered using the Draft or Quality Render mode.

Red dashed line shows where the Workplane intersects the solid

 

3D Slice by Workplane

Ribbon : Modify | 3D Modifications | 3D Slice | right click | Slice by Workplane Right click displays options for this function. Options are also shown in the status bar at the base of the editor
Default Menu : | Modify | Modify 3D Objects | 3D Boolean Operations | 3D Slice | right click | Slice by Workplane Right click displays options for this function. Options are also shown in the status bar at the base of the editor
Palette : 3D Model | 3D Modify | Boolean & Facet | Slice | | right click | Slice by Workplane Right click displays options for this function. Options are also shown in the status bar at the base of the editor
A solid object can be sliced in the plane where the solid object intersects with the Workplane.The sliced portion, either side of the Workplane, can be retained or discarded.

Select the 3D Slice tool from the menu options above. Select the Slice by Workplane option from the base of the workspace, shown above left.

Use this Workplane to slice the Sphere.  Do not delete the sliced portion at this stage. The 2 separate portions of the sphere are shown below.
